Introduction to the Bonefish
Before diving into the etymology of the bonefish’s name, it’s essential to understand what the bonefish is. The bonefish, scientifically known as Albula vulpes, is a species of fish that belongs to the family Albulidae. It is found in warm, shallow waters around the globe, including the Atlantic, Pacific, and Indian Oceans. Bonefish are known for their slender bodies, typically silver or gray in color, with a distinctive snout and a penchant for inhabiting areas with soft bottoms, such as sand flats and sea grass beds. Their diet consists mainly of small crustaceans, mollusks, and other invertebrates, which they forage for in the sediment.

Habitat and Distribution
Bonefish inhabit a variety of shallow, tropical, and subtropical environments. They are found in waters that are typically less than 20 feet deep, preferring areas with abundant food sources and suitable hiding places, such as coral reefs, estuaries, and mangrove swamps. Their wide distribution across the world’s oceans reflects their adaptability and the diversity of their habitats.

What are the main threats to bonefish populations?
Bonefish populations are facing a number of threats, including habitat degradation, overfishing, and climate change. Habitat degradation, such as the destruction of mangrove swamps and coral reefs, can reduce the availability of food and shelter for bonefish, making it harder for them to survive. Overfishing, including both commercial and recreational fishing, can also deplete bonefish populations and reduce their ability to reproduce. Climate change is another major threat to bonefish populations, as it can cause changes in water temperature and chemistry that can make it harder for bonefish to survive.
In addition to these threats, bonefish populations are also vulnerable to other human activities, such as coastal development and pollution. Coastal development, such as the construction of seawalls and jetties, can alter the bonefish’s habitat and reduce its ability to migrate and spawn. Pollution, including both chemical and noise pollution, can also harm bonefish populations by reducing their ability to communicate and find food. As a result, it is essential to take steps to protect bonefish populations, including conserving their habitat, reducing overfishing, and mitigating the impacts of climate change.

What are the best techniques for catching bonefish?
The best techniques for catching bonefish depend on the specific fishing location and the time of year. In general, bonefish are most active in shallow, warm water, where they can be caught using a variety of techniques, including fly fishing, spinning, and baitcasting. Anglers often use small, lightweight lures or baits, such as shrimp or crab imitations, to catch bonefish, and must be prepared to make quick, accurate casts to target the fish. Bonefish are also highly sensitive to vibrations in the water, so anglers must use a gentle presentation and avoid making too much noise or disturbance.
In addition to the choice of tackle and technique, the timing and location of the fishing trip are also critical factors in catching bonefish. Bonefish are most active during the warmer months of the year, when the water temperature is between 70 and 90 degrees Fahrenheit. They are also more likely to be found in areas with abundant food and shelter, such as mangrove swamps or coral reefs.
